"Might as well... when was the last time Nintendo themselves actually made a Starfox game? I believe it was Starfox 64. Lately Nintendo has been whoring out their franchises to third parties *cough* Starfox *cough* F-Zero *cough* or second parties or other smaller internal developer groups because they can't be bothered to do it themselves."

Starfox Assault and Command were freaking amazing, same with Starfox Adventures. Also, F-Zero GX is my second favourite F-Zero game as well as second favourite racing game.

 

Yes, but my point was that NONE of those Starfox games were developed internally by Nintendo.  Adventures was originally Rare's N64 effort Dinosaur Planet, which was brought over to GC and slapped with the Starfox license at the request of Shiggy.  Assault on the GC was handled by Namco and was pretty mediocre, and Command was developed by Q-games, who are known for their PixelJunk games.

And i agree F-Zero GX was great, but again, that was Sega's Amusement Vision (of Super Monkey Ball fame) and not Nintendo that develped that.

This doesn't necessarily bother me as most Nintendo franchises have turned out pretty well in the hands of other companies/develpers... see the Metroid Prime series by Retro and the Donkey Kong Country and 64 games by Rare, and whatever franchise Factor 5 is working on i know that it's in very good hands so I'm not worried about that.
